IP Group PLC 2022 AR2
The report highlights IP Group plc's progress in 2022, focusing on its three investment themes: regenerative, healthier, and tech-enriched futures. Key achievements include First Light Fusion's world-first projectile-based inertial confinement fusion result and Oxbotica's $140 million Series C financing. Despite macroeconomic headwinds leading to a loss of #344.5 million, primarily driven by a reduction in the value of public companies like Oxford Nanopore, the private portfolio remained robust with 90% of funding rounds at or above previous valuations. The company also launched Kiko Ventures, its dedicated cleantech platform, and successfully issued #120 million in private debt to support future investments.
